How they compare
Palau currently reports 12.65 % change on previous year against 1.33 % change on previous year in Post-demographic dividend, a difference of 11.32 % change on previous year.
That makes Palau's figure about 9.5 times Post-demographic dividend's.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 19 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Post-demographic dividend ahead.
Palau ranks 25th and Post-demographic dividend ranks 26th of 161 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Palau averaged higher in 1 and Post-demographic dividend in 2.
